What is Belief in Life?

Belief in life is the sturdy foundation upon which self-improvement stands. It’s the unwavering trust in your ability to grow, change, and become the best version of yourself. When you believe in life’s potential for growth, you set the stage for personal development.

Example

Imagine a young artist, Amya, who dreams of becoming a renowned painter. She starts with basic skills, unsure if she’ll ever reach her desired level of mastery. However, Amya firmly believes in life’s capacity for growth. This belief fuels her dedication. She practices daily, seeks guidance, and embraces challenges. Even when faced with failures or doubts, her belief remains unshaken.

This belief becomes Amya’s driving force. As she paints and learns, she sees incremental improvements over time. With each new artwork, she hones her skills, refines her technique, and gains confidence. Her belief in life’s potential transforms her into a skilled artist, one brushstroke at a time.

In the context of self-improvement, belief in life means recognizing that your current state is not fixed, but rather a starting point. Just as Amya’s belief in her artistic growth propelled her forward, your belief in life’s transformative power can inspire you to embrace challenges, learn from mistakes, and continuously evolve.

Why Belief in Life is Important?

Belief in life is vital because it shapes your mindset, influencing how you approach challenges and opportunities.

  1. Unlocks Potential – When you believe in life, you tap into your hidden capabilities, realizing you can achieve more than you thought.
  2. Positive Outlook – Believing in life fosters optimism, helping you see setbacks as temporary and surmountable.
  3. Resilience Builder – It fuels your resilience, enabling you to bounce back from failures with newfound determination.
  4. Motivation Source – Belief in life becomes your inner cheerleader, pushing you forward when the going gets tough.
  5. Embracing Change – It encourages you to welcome change as a chance for growth, rather than a daunting hurdle.

How Beliefs Affect Your Self-Improvement?

Your beliefs set the tone for your self-improvement journey. They determine whether you view challenges as opportunities or obstacles.

  • Negative beliefs can hold you back. If you believe you can’t change, your progress might stall. Positive beliefs, however, fuel growth.
  • Your beliefs can shape your actions. If you believe you’re capable of improvement, you’re more likely to take steps to improve.
  • Believing in your potential encourages you to take risks, try new things, and step outside your comfort zone.
  • Strong beliefs keep you going. When setbacks happen, belief in your ability to overcome motivates you to persist.
